PART 1 – Admissions to the 2023/2024 school year.

Application and Decision Dates for admission to the 2023/2024.

The following are the dates applicable for admission to junior infants/first year (delete as appropriate):

The school will commence accepting applications for admission on  1/10/2022
The school shall cease accepting applications for admission on  31/3/2023
The date by which applicants will be notified of the decision on their application is  21/4/2023
The period within which applicants must confirm acceptance of an offer of admission is*  7 days from date of offer.

*Failure to accept an offer within the prescribed period above may result in the offer being withdrawn.

Note: the school will consider and issue decisions on late applications in accordance with the school’s Admission Policy.
